In response to a direct question over Spotify’s failure to bring the HiFi service to the public as promised, Ek only provided a vague answer before moving on. Speaking to analysts and investors during Spotify’s quarterly and annual earnings release on Wednesday, Ek stated that the company doesn’t have much to share about its plans for the HiFi tier, but noted discussions were ongoing. We bring you more insightful Spotify HiFi leaks as they happen.Spotify CEO Daniel Ek has hinted that the delay of the streaming service’s HiFi subscription tier is related to licensing issues. Since then, Apple Music has introduced lossless and spatial audio at no additional cost. Spotify originally announced Spotify HiFi in February, revealing that it had CD-quality designs on a subscription level that would hit the market as an add-on to Spotify Premium in 2021.
